Vrchní část Mobilní aplikace Flutter Vývojová společnost

Vývoj aplikací Flutter je oblíbenou volbou pro vytváření mobilních aplikací pro různé platformy s jedinou kódovou základnou. Flutter, vyvinutý společností Google, nabízí rychlý a efektivní rámec pro vytváření vysoce výkonných aplikací, které bezproblémově fungují na platformách Android i iOS. Díky svému reaktivnímu uživatelskému rozhraní, funkci horkého načítání a rozsáhlé knihovně widgetů umožňuje Flutter rychlý vývoj aplikací a poskytuje uživatelům nativní zážitek. Flutter také nabízí bohatou sadu předpřipravených komponent uživatelského rozhraní, vynikající dokumentaci a velkou komunitu vývojářů, díky čemuž je preferovanou volbou pro podniky a vývojáře, kteří chtějí vytvářet vizuálně přitažlivé, výkonné a cenově výhodné mobilní aplikace.

Při vývoji aplikace Flutter bere Sigosoft v úvahu různé faktory, aby zajistil úspěšnou a vysoce kvalitní aplikaci:


Vývoj napříč platformami

Vývoj napříč platformami

Flutterova schopnost vytvářet aplikace, které bezproblémově fungují na platformách Android i iOS s jedinou kódovou základnou, je významnou výhodou. Společnost Sigosoft však aplikaci pečlivě plánuje a navrhuje tak, aby zajistila konzistentní uživatelskou zkušenost na různých platformách, přičemž bere v úvahu rozdíly v návrhových vzorech a očekávání uživatelů jednotlivých platforem.

Design UI/UX

Design UI/UX

Flutter nabízí bohatou sadu předpřipravených komponent uživatelského rozhraní, ale je důležité navrhnout uživatelské rozhraní a uživatelské rozhraní aplikace s pečlivým zvážením cílového publika aplikace a pokynů pro návrh specifických pro platformu. Dodržování pokynů Flutter's Material Design pro Android a pokynů Cupertino Design pro iOS může pomoci vytvořit vizuálně přitažlivou a intuitivní aplikaci.

Výkon a optimalizace

Výkon a optimalizace

Zatímco Flutter je známý svým rychlým a efektivním výkonem, optimalizace aplikace pro výkon je zásadní pro zajištění hladkého a citlivého uživatelského zážitku. To zahrnuje optimalizaci kódu, minimalizaci využití zdrojů a využití nástrojů pro profilování výkonu společnosti Flutter k identifikaci a řešení úzkých míst výkonu.

Testování a zajištění kvality

Testování a zajištění kvality

Přísné testování a zajištění kvality jsou zásadní pro zajištění stability, funkčnosti a kompatibility aplikace napříč různými zařízeními a platformami. Důkladné testování aplikace na různých zařízeních, velikostech obrazovky a orientaci a řešení případných chyb nebo problémů je zásadní pro poskytování vysoce kvalitní aplikace uživatelům.

Integrace s nativními funkcemi

Integrace s nativními funkcemi

Flutter umožňuje snadnou integraci s nativními funkcemi platforem Android i iOS, jako je fotoaparát, GPS a senzory. Je však důležité tyto integrace pečlivě naplánovat a implementovat s ohledem na rozdíly v nativních rozhraních API a chování různých platforem.

Komunita a podpora

Komunita a podpora

Flutter má velkou a aktivní komunitu vývojářů, kteří poskytují přístup k rozsáhlé dokumentaci, návodům a fórům podpory. Využití těchto zdrojů a sledování nejnovějších aktualizací a osvědčených postupů ve vývoji Flutter může být přínosné.

Náklady na vývoj a údržbu

Náklady na vývoj a údržbu

Vývoj aplikací Flutter může být nákladově efektivní ve srovnání s vytvářením samostatných aplikací pro platformy Android a iOS. Je však důležité stanovit rozpočet na vývoj a průběžnou údržbu, včetně aktualizací pro nové verze Flutter a změn specifických pro platformu.

Stručně řečeno, Sigosoft zvažuje různé faktory, jako je vývoj napříč platformami, design UI/UX, optimalizace výkonu, testování a zajištění kvality, integrace s nativními funkcemi, podpora komunity a rozpočet na vývoj a údržbu, aby byla zajištěna úspěšná aplikace Flutter.